“..Thousands cracks Roovere The clarified that it is thousands of cracks, with a diameter of approximately 2 inches. Immediate risk of a leak in the reactor vessel is not, however, because the cracks are almost parallel with the surface. There must now determine whether the cracks may evolve into a dangerous situation….”
